The problem is that making such a diagnosis goes against their own professional organization code of ethics. They can say anything they want to about Trump, or any other public official, but to diagnose him without an actual examination is against their own rules. Just as it would be wrong for a group of conservative doctors to come out with a statement that they believe Joe Biden is suffering from dementia or Alzheimer's.
The drive to inject every institution and profession with politics will lead to no institution or profession being trusted, by large groups of people. Such a loss of trust will harm everyone.

Allen Frances, a Duke psychiatry professor who led the task force that wrote the fourth edition of the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ders, pushed back against the psychiatric diagnoses of the president. In a letter to the New York Times, he wrote, [bold] “It is a stigmatizing insult to the mentally ill (who are mostly well behaved and well meaning) to be lumped with Mr. Trump (who is neither) … Psychiatric name-calling is a misguided way of countering Mr. Trump’s attack on democracy.” [bold]
